I have looked up my list of production changes and determined that from CT-40028 onwards the R975-EC2 engine was replaced by the R975-C1, leading to alterations of the lower hull back plate because of changes in exhaust. This means the Ram Kangaroo in this picture was one of the first 247 built, but most likely a Ram II with hull side doors (these were discared shortly after the change in engine type). The only picture of a Ram Kangaroo with hull side doors I have seen is on Henk Kuipers' website (see below). Personally I'm convinced these Ram Kangaroos were painted SCC2.
